Summary
This gene is a member of the paired box (PAX) family of transcription factors. Members of this gene family typically contain a paired box domain, an octapeptide, and a paired-type homeodomain. These genes play critical roles during fetal development and cancer growth. The specific function of the paired box 7 gene is unknown but speculated to involve tumor suppression since fusion of this gene with a forkhead domain family member has been associated with alveolar rhabdomyosarcoma. Three transcript variants encoding different isoforms have been found for this gene.
Gene References into function
- PAX7-FKHR gene fusion is prognostic indicator for alveolar rhabdomyosarcoma.
- expression of PAX7 is correlated with metastasis potential--REVIEW
- elevated PAX7 expression indicates myogenic satellite cell origin for embryonal rhabdomyosarcoma
- in the RD embryonal rhabdomyosarcoma cell line, expression of wild-type PAX7 is downregulated by PAX3-FKHR
- PAX3, PAX7 and their fusions with FKHR are each expressed in rhabdomyosarcoma tumors as a consistent mixture of functionally distinct isoforms
- PAX 7-FKHR fusion transcripts were positive in 2/7 of alveolar rhabdomyosarcoma patients, and were negative in embryonal rhabdomyosarcoma and Control tumors.
- Significant differences in survival and clinical characteristics between PAX3-FKHR and PAX7-FKHR positive tumors were seen indicating their role in carcinogenesis.
- An amplification event is required for the PAX7-FOXO1A chimeric transcript to reach a critical expression level.
- Detection of PAX3/7-FKHR fusion gene by one-step RT-PCR is useful in the diagnosis of rhabdomyosarcomas (RMS) and that AChR-gamma is overexpressed in Chinese RMS patients.
- Results identified a differentiation-resistant skeletal muscle progenitor cell population that was Pax7+/desmin- and capable of self-renewal.
